WebFor example, the nominal size of one of the most popular furnace filter sizes is 20 x 25 x 1 inches. The actual furnace filter size measures to 19.5 x 24.25 x 0.75 inches. Nominal sizes are used to simplify furnace filter sizes. Rest assured, most furnace filters have both sizes printed on the sides.
